I tested the versions from Windows 98 and XP. Some help files contain links which when clicked open a pop-up box. The box has a semi-transparent shadow effect to the right and below, achieved by rendering alternate pixels of the shadow area black. In Wine, sometimes the shadow is rendered entirely in black. Whether it's rendered correctly or in black doesn't seem to be consistent; you can click a popup link many times and sometimes the shadow is rendered correctly, other times in black. Or on a page with multiple popup links, clicking on different links gives a different result. Try viewing the attached FACTS.HLP in Microsoft winhlp32 under Wine.
